Average Movie Ticket Price Falls Below $8

It’s getting a tiny bit cheaper to see a film, according to the National Association of Theater Owners

It's getting a little cheaper to go to the movies. 

The average ticket price fell to $7.94 over the third quarter, the National Association of Theater Owners announced on Tuesday. 

That's down from the $8.06 ticket buyers spent on average during the second quarter of this year.

That passed the previous high of $8.01, set in the fourth quarter of 2010. 

The third quarter's slide is possibly attributable to the decline in the number of 3D films released from second-quarter months May and June to July. 

Year to date, the average ticket now stands at $7.96.
